Glass

Double-glazed windows are made up of two panes and an air space between them. The air is typically filled with a gas, such as argon or krypton, which slows the passage of heat through your windows. This allows you to keep your home at a comfortable temperature without putting too much strain on your cooling and heating system. It is essential to repair your double-glazed windows as soon as it gets cracked or damaged.

Typically replacing the glass in your double-glazed window is the best solution to repair it. However, it's important to understand that repairing a double-paned window is more than just replacing the glass. It also requires restoring the factory seal to allow your upvc window repair near me to function as it should. This is the reason it's better to call in an expert for double glazing repairs instead of trying to do it yourself.

A common issue that double glazed windows suffer from is misting. This happens when the seal around a glass panel fails, allowing moisture-laden air to be able to get into the panes of glass. This could cause the window to become foggy or wet. It can also reduce the insulation capacity of your double glazed windows.

To repair a double glazed window the first step is to remove the pane from the frame. To prevent further damage to your glass, you should take care when removing the existing pane. The next step is to remove any sealants or paints from the edges of the glass. This can be done with either a putty knife, or a scraper. Once the old pane is removed, the new one can be placed inside the frame. A new layer of sealant should then be applied.

It is crucial to find a double-glazing company who has experience working with historic buildings, especially if you have a listed building. In many cases, it's possible to fit slim profile double glazed units into listed structures without compromising the style of the property. These windows can be made to look like the original windows, and will keep your home warm without compromising its historic appeal.
